## Artifact Signing for Blue-Green Deploys

The Lumberjack billing worker ships via blue-green rotation on the Fernwheel platform. Plugin authors must sign every artifact before the green slot accepts it; unsigned bundles are rejected at admission, not at runtime, so failures surface early. Verify your manifest hash matches the build output exactly. All green-slot promotions for Lumberjack are validated against the key below.

deploy key for yagef-bafof: bky13_7XSsjPzjdWU3k

# tailwatch: internal CLI for tailing service logs across the Brindlehop fleet.
# New folks: this tool streams log lines from the aggregator, applies your
# filters client-side, and backs off automatically when the aggregator is
# under load. Most behavior you will want to adjust lives in the constants
# below rather than in flags, because ops prefers consistent defaults across
# everyone's machines. Change them only after checking with the platform
# channel. The tuning constants are as follows.

constants for kahag-yagag:
BUDGETS = {
    "tamax": 449,
    "holiel": 156,
    "isteth": 181,
    "silath": 575,
    "zorys": 821,
    "briax": 1007,
    "quenox": 276,
}

## Deploying the Gatewick Proctor Queue

Deploys are pretty painless: push to main, wait for the pipeline, then watch the queue drain dashboard for five minutes. If candidates pile up mid-exam, roll back first and ask questions later — the queue replays safely. Everything the workers care about lives in one config block, shown here for reference.

settings of bafof-yagef:
JOROX_PIN=8740
JOROX_TENANT=pelox
JOROX_METRICS_HOST=metrics.jorox.qorvelworks.internal
JOROX_SEAL=seal_c78f63c1
JOROX_STANDBY_TEAM=norax

Ticket #4471 — Signature check failing on load-test build

Hey support folks — the Bramblecart load-test harness is refusing the latest checkout-flow build with "signature mismatch." Nothing's wrong with the flow itself; we hammered checkout at 5k sessions fine last week. Looks like the harness cached the old verification key after Tuesday's rotation, so every artifact gets bounced. Fix: clear the harness keystore and re-pin. To save you digging through the Oakmere vault, the current deploy key it should trust is the following.

signing key of bagap-yawep = bky13_TbfT6ZMUoGJo2